What is the Oregon Move-In Accounting Form?
The Oregon Move-In Accounting Form serves as a crucial document used by landlords and tenants to document the financial aspects of a residential lease agreement in Oregon. This form functions to clearly outline rent payments, security deposits, and any additional charges related to the lease. It requires the necessary signatures from both the resident and the owner or agent to be legally binding.

Who needs to sign the Oregon Move-In Accounting Form?
Both the resident and the owner/agent are required to sign the Oregon Move-In Accounting Form, ensuring that all parties agree to the financial terms documented within.
What information does the Oregon Move-In Accounting Form require?
The form requires information such as the resident's name, property details, rent amount, security deposit, additional charges, and any special adjustments related to the lease agreement.

Is notarization required for this form?
No, notarization is not required for the Oregon Move-In Accounting Form, making it straightforward for both parties to complete and sign without additional steps.
